EDWARDS CO., Ill. - Edwards County State's Attorney Mike Valentine has announced that 18-year old Brendan L. Schell of Mt. Carmel was sentenced today in the Edwards County Circuit Court by Hon. Judge David Frankland to 8 years in the Illinois Department of Corrections.
Schell was also ordered to pay $254.00 restitution to Casey’s as well as court costs. As part of the plea agreement, Schell’s lesser charge of a Class 3 Felony Intimidation was dismissed.
State’s Attorney Valentine commended the work of Chief Roy Mann and Officer Mike Brown of the Grayville Police Department in their investigation of this case as well as the assistance of the Illinois State Police and the Mt. Carmel Police Department in apprehending the defendant. Valentine also commended the employees and manager of the Grayville Casey’s General Store for their participation in aiding in investigation as well as their participation and testimony during preliminary court proceedings.
